An N-level inverter has 'N' discrete levels in the pole voltage, and hence multilevel inverter can be viewed as a multi-valued logic device. A space vector pulse width modulation (SVPWM) scheme for multilevel inverter is presented based on the principle of multi-valued logic. The multi-valued logic operations are utilized to realize a computationally efficient space vector PWM scheme. The algorithm used to realize the reference space vector are generated using multi-valued logic. The scheme is experimentally verified using a 3-level inverter in cascade configuration and experimental results are presented to validate the scheme.
